/**
|
||||
* Handles BungeeCord Plugin Messaging.
|
||||
*
|
||||
* Cross-server teleport flow (fixed):
|
||||
* 1. Query the target server for the exact coordinates of the target player (QUERY_LOCATION).
|
||||
* 2. Target server replies with LOCATION_RESPONSE (world, x, y, z, yaw, pitch).
|
||||
* 3. We send a LOCATION payload to the target server so it teleports the mover on arrival.
|
||||
* 4. We send the BungeeCord Connect/ConnectOther to actually switch the server.
|
||||
*
|
||||
* Step 3 happens *before* step 4 to avoid the race condition where the player
|
||||
* arrives on the target server before the teleport payload does.
|
||||
* A 1-second timeout falls back to the TP_TO_PLAYER polling mechanism.
|
||||
*/
